UTEP’s Niesha Burgher won her second Conference USA Outdoor Female Track Athlete of the Week honor as announced by league officials on Tuesday. All C-USA weekly awards are presented by Blenders Eyewear.

Burgher sprinted out to an impressive performance in the 100-meter dash despite the windy conditions at the Don Kirby Tailwind Open hosted by New Mexico on April 20. Burgher clocked in an 11.23 (3.5) and finished in second place overall. Burgher’s time, due to the high winds, doesn’t count towards her personal-best, however the time still ranks 25th nationally and first in Conference USA.
Her previous weekly honor came on April 11 after placing first in the women’s 200-meter dash, clocking in a personal-best 23.19 at the 2023 New Mexico Spring Invitational in Albuquerque at the UNM Track & Field Complex on April 6. Burgher added a second PR, churning out a 53.69 in the women’s 400-meter race and placing second.
Burgher is the first UTEP female track athlete to win the weekly honor multiple times during an outdoor season since Tobi Amusan did so in 2017 (March 28, April 4).
